  7. badgas

    Where in the line should compression be?

    I use mine after the EQ and before the DSP. But switching it around will give you some new effects. The choice depends on what sound your looking to get.

  11. badgas

    Equalizer

    I use a two channel 31 band Behringer Graphic EQ and a two channel Behringer Parametric EQ. I've been recording my bass tracks for the past two weeks and I'm not disappointed. I'd suggest a parametric. Mainly because you can control the exact freq if you have a boom or a shallow sound. You can...
